I'm 38 and remember days of 300 baud modems..where we would wait 5 minutes for a line of text. The internet though has been around along time. I played on Muds before the WWW showed up (text based online games) which were incredibly addictive. Before that I played on a BBS called Phospher mainly which had many fun games like crossroads and LANDS I-III.

Back before that we had great games like bards tale, wizardry, Might and Magic etc. There was of course the original nintendo system as well which really is when console gaming started to shine.

I had a TRS 80, APPLE II, C64 and Atari 2600. I even programed in basic on the original Apple while in elementary school creating a brick out game, a dinosaur racing game and a spaceship maze game for everyone in my school to play.
